Abstract

Vietnam has achieved remarkable socio-economic development in the last 30 years. Economic growth has been maintained since 1990 until now. However, economic growth has been unsustainable, caused environmental pollution and depletion of natural resources. On the other hand, Vietnam is one of the most seriously impacted countries by the climate change. In this context, there is a need to change the growth paradigm, to promote Green Growth. This paper identifies potential as well as solutions and recommendations of integrated solid waste management including resource recovery from municipal waste for Green Growth in Vietnam.
